Public Enemy
Research According to Captain Tom, it was formed in early 1989.2 One of the top 4 IBM PC games groups in 1990. It was known for releasing non-English releases with delayed translations. FiRM
Research The acronym FiRM probably came from the phrase “First in Release Media” or “First in Release Movement”.
